Equally important to the narrative are the lifestyle elements that provide these stories with their distinct flavor and authenticity. Indian lifestyle storytelling is a sensory experience. It is conveyed through the depiction of festivals like Diwali and Holi, which serve as narrative devices to bring estranged family members together or to trigger climactic confrontations. Furthermore, food is never merely a prop in these stories; it is a language of love, resentment, and memory. The act of a mother cooking a elaborate meal can signify affection, while a daughter-in-law’s inability to replicate a traditional recipe can become a source of systemic familial tension.
